Blue Fields, March 9 All except L6 of the entombed miners have been resoued. and two are known to be dend.
Those unaccounted for
are trapped in No 5 mine, where nearly 200 miners were killed in a similar explosion in 1914.

Rugby, March 9, The official weekly return showa a further decrease of 18,680) in the number of unemployed,
